A regular quadrilateral (which is a square) has both point symmetry and line symmetry.

  • Line symmetry: 4 lines of symmetry (vertical, horizontal, and the two diagonals).
  • Point (rotational) symmetry: rotational symmetry of order 4; it looks the same after rotations of 90°, 180°, 270°, and 360° about its center.
